Correction on: Chen Y, Chen Y, Han X, Yang Z. Comparative effectiveness of gamified binocular treatment versus conventional patching for amblyopia: a randomized clinical trial. Front Med (Lausanne). 2025;12:1560203. Published 2025 Jun 2. doi:10.3389/fmed.2025.1560203 Equal contribution statement Missing In the published article, Ying Chen and Yuzhen Chen were erroneously omitted as equal contributing authors. The corrected statement reads: 'Ying Chen and Yuzhen Chen contributed equally to this work and share first authorship.' The original version of this article has been updated.
